Machine Operator – Die Setup

location York, Pennsylvania

Apply Now

Our client, a precision metals manufacturer, has an immediate need for an experienced Die Setup Machine Operator, to join their winning team in York.

Our candidate of choice will install dies into stamping presses and set-up auxiliary equipment to complete jobs according to specifications, load die and inspect parts to print and adjust die as needed to achieve an acceptable part.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Install and remove dies from presses.
  • Set-up auxiliary equipment to specifications.
  • Load die, check sample parts to customer print and complete QIP.
  • Utilize quality assurance practices and metrology equipment to ensure that product conforms to applicable design specifications.
  • Consult manager if any tooling may need to be modified from print and record modification.
  • Utilize good housekeeping practices to maintain a clean & safe work area.
  • Complete all documentation in a timely and accurate manner.
  • Record maintenance steps in Die Log Book.

KEY REQUIREMENTS:  

  • High School Graduate or equivalent.
  • Six months vocational training or 2 years in the field of stamping.
  • Ability to perform basic math functions using whole numbers, fractions and decimals including metric /English conversion. A basic understanding of algebra and geometry.
  • Ability to read and interpret documents such as safety rules, set-up, operating and maintenance instructions.
  • Knowledge of measuring equipment usage, such as micrometer, caliper and optical comparator.
  • Blue print reading with geometric tolerances.
  • Ability to read die assemblies, change-over and detail prints from various sources.
  • Capable of writing routine correspondence and reports.
  • Ability to solve practical and mechanical problems (Mechanical aptitude).
  • Ability to interpret a variety of instructions furnished in written, oral, diagram, or schedule form.
  • Must have the ability to successfully complete all training requirements as listed on training matrix for this position.
  • Must be available for scheduled work: normal work day of 8 hours or more as necessary, night shift and weekend work is possible.
